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Westlake Village is $143,424, which is significantly higher than the national average / 91% above $75,149. This places Westlake Village among higher-income communities. The unemployment rate of 5.7% is somewhat elevated compared to the national rate of 3.6%. Only 2.8%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 29 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Westlake Village is $210,900, 25% below the national median / offering relatively affordable homeownership. At just 1.5x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Safety & Crime

Westlake Village is a very safe community with a violent crime rate of 0 per 100,000 residents / well below the national average of 380. Property crime occurs at a rate of 1,512 per 100,000, 23% below the national average.

Education

28.2%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 100.0%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 4.7/10.

Climate & Weather

Westlake Village exper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 49°F. Winters average 22°F in January while summers reach 74°F in July. With 260 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 37.2 inches, including 37.1 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43.

Westlake Village has a population of 1,282 with a density of 1,393 people per square mile, spread across 0.9 square miles. The median age is 43.5 years, 12% older than the national median of 38.9. The gender split is 41.6% female and 58.4% male. The city is predominantly White (92.2%), with 3.3% Hispanic. English is the primary language spoken at home by 99.2% of residents. 2.9% of the population are veterans, below the national rate of 6.0%. 13.8% of residents have a disability. 99.1% have health insurance coverage.

The median household income in Westlake Village is $143,424, which is 91% above the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$55,163 (above the $39,052 national figure). The average weekly wage is $1,142, 20% lower than the U.S. average. The unemployment rate is 5.7% (above the 3.6% US average). 2.8% of residents live below the poverty line, lower than the national rate of 12.4%. The area has 5,870 business establishments, including 623 restaurants. The cost of living index is 100, roughly in line with the national average. Workers commute an average of 29 minutes. 12.7% of workers work from home.

The median home value in Westlake Village is $210,900, 25%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home value at $225,947. Homes sell for 97.9% of their list price. Fair market rent ranges from $854 for a one-bedroom to $1,063 for a two-bedroom apartment. 100.0% of housing units are owner-occupied (above the 65.4% national rate). There are 502 total housing units in the city. The median year a home was built is 2003. The average annual property tax is $6,763 (higher than the $3,500 national average). 29.3% of renters spend 30% or more of their income on housing. The home price-to-income ratio is 1.5x, well within the affordable range.

In Westlake Village, 37.3% of adults are obese, above the national rate of 32.1%. 8.6% have diabetes (below the 10.5% national rate). Heart disease affects 4.7% of residents, below the national average. 29.2% have high blood pressure. 12.4% are current smokers. 20.9% report binge drinking. 19.0% are physically inactive, below the national average. 24.2% report depression (above the 20.0% national average). 17.7% experience frequent mental distress. 6.9% of residents lack health insurance. The primary care physician ratio is 1:1,423. The dentist ratio is 1:1,171. 90.0% of residents have access to exercise opportunities. The food environment index is 7.6 out of 10.

Westlake Village experiences four distinct seasons with an average annual temperature of 49°F (10°C). Winters average 22°F in January while summers reach 74°F in July. The area gets 260 sunny days per year, above the national average. Annual precipitation totals 37.2 inches. The area receives 37.1 inches of snow annually, a moderate snowfall amount.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43. The city sits at an elevation of 801 feet.
